Insert images and media
- 1 Insert Image - uses File picker
- 2 Insert Emoticon
- 3 Insert Media - uses File picker
- 4 Insert Equation - uses java script editor
- 5 Insert Non breaking space
- 6 Insert Custom character - Special keyboard characters
- 7 Insert Table -
